利用RAPD标记评价桃种间杂交一代群体的分离方式Evaluation of Segregation Patterns of Peach in an Interspecific F1 Hybrid with RAPD Markers
乔飞,王力荣,范崇辉,朱更瑞,方伟超
摘要(Abstract):
以毛桃2-7(Prunus persica)、山桃白山碧桃(Prunus davidiana)以及两者的F_1代为试材,对RAPD标记的分离方式进行分析。结果表明,RAPD标记在F_1代呈3种分离方式:孟德尔分离、偏离孟德尔分离规律、异常分离。3种分离位点出现的频率和数量分别为:80%、240,14%、42,6%、18。呈孟德尔分离的情况有:不分离、1:1分离和3:1分离,其中不分离的频率为64%。并对偏离孟德尔分离比例和异常分离的RAPD标记进行分析。其研究结果可为该群体是否适合构建遗传连锁图谱进行评价及进一步利用该群体奠定良好基础。
关键词(KeyWords): 桃;RAPD标记;分离方式;多态性
